Identifying and cultivating student superpowers involves recognizing the unique abilities that each learner brings to the classroom. Discovering unique abilities requires a keen observation of students' strengths, interests, and learning styles. Educators can use various strategies such as personalized assessments and student interviews to uncover these hidden talents. For example, implementing strengths-based assessments can help highlight individual skills, allowing teachers to tailor their instruction accordingly. By focusing on what students excel at, educators can create a more engaging and motivating learning environment.
Once students' superpowers are identified, it’s essential to cultivate these abilities effectively. This can be achieved through differentiated instruction and providing opportunities for hands-on experiences that align with their interests. Teachers can encourage collaboration by forming groups that allow students to share their strengths and learn from one another. Additionally, offering mentorship programs and real-world projects can nurture these talents further. By celebrating and supporting each student's unique abilities, educators can empower students to thrive academically and personally, ultimately fostering a culture of growth and resilience.

The concept of the Superpower Spectrum recognizes that students come equipped with a diverse array of talents and abilities that extend far beyond conventional academic metrics. Just as a spectrum features a range of colors, students exhibit varying strengths—from creative problem-solving in artistic fields to analytical reasoning in mathematics. By embracing this diversity, educators can foster an environment where each student’s unique superpower is acknowledged and cultivated, promoting not just individual growth but a richer learning community.

In today's rapidly evolving educational landscape, students are often seen solely through the lens of standardized test scores and academic grades. However, there is a rich tapestry of hidden talents waiting to be discovered beyond the classroom walls. These talents may include exceptional creativity, leadership skills, or innate problem-solving abilities. Recognizing and nurturing these qualities not only fuels students' passions but also empowers them to thrive in their future endeavors. Many students excel in areas such as art, music, and technology, showcasing their capabilities in innovative ways that traditional assessments may overlook.
The key to unlocking these potential hidden talents lies in providing diverse opportunities for exploration and self-expression. Educational institutions can foster environments that encourage students to participate in extracurricular activities like clubs, sports, or community service projects, which can unearth these skills. Moreover, incorporating collaborative learning experiences can allow students to shine in ways that individual assessments do not. By embracing a holistic approach to education, we can ensure that every student has the chance to discover and develop their unique abilities, preparing them for success in an increasingly complex world.
